Boise State splits on Sunday

3/20/2022 8:26:00 PM | Women's Beach Volleyball

The Broncos fell to No. 10 Cal, then beat Houston Baptist.

SAN LUIS OBISPO, Calif. - Boise State's beach volleyball team earned a split on Sunday in San Luis Obispo, Calif., falling 5-0 to 10th-ranked Cal, then defeated Houston Baptist 4-1. 

The Broncos, who started a three-day road trip to California on Saturday at Northridge, are now a combined 3-1 this weekend with two more matches scheduled for Monday in San Luis Obispo versus 12th-ranked Cal Poly — the host school — and Santa Clara. Boise State is now 10-7 overall on the year. 

Versus the Cal Bears, the No. 2 and 3 pairs led the Broncos by taking their contests to third sets before falling. Rorianna Chartier and Sierra Land rallied from a set down to tie it with a set two victory but were unable to close it out in third as Cal's duo of Ava Mann and Ainsley Radell came back to edge Boise State tandem 21-19, 19-21, 15-8.

The No. 3 team of Boss and Nichols also battled to the end, winning set one before falling in three to Brooke Buchner and Ashley Delgado 19-21, 21-9, 15-12.

In the win over Houston Baptist in the afternoon, the Blue and Orange regrouped to win three pairs in straight sets and a fourth in three. Boss and Nichols recorded the first win, easily defeating Kristen Kleymeyer and Lindsay Harris 21-13, 21-13 to claim their ninth victory of the year. 

After HBU had tied it up at 1-1, Boise State put it away with wins in the final three contests starting with the No. 5 pair. In their first competition together, Katie Martin and Kaylee Mejia wasted little time notching their first win beating Abbey Reinard and Mary Alper in straight sets 21-13, 21-17 on court five.

Erin Martin and Yasmin Tan made it 3-1 Broncos when they dispatched the Huskies' top duo of Brennan Miller and Maddie Butters 21-13, 21-17. The victory gave the pair seven on the year on court one.

Joey Benson and Emilia Guerra-Acuna won the final match on court four. They rallied from a set down to defeat Danielle Okeke and Shleby O'Neal 19-21, 23-21, 15-9, collecting their eighth win of the season.
